Practical Application: Choosing the Right Paint Colors for Your Remodel
When opting for a minimalist bathroom remodel, selecting the right paint colors is paramount to creating an airy atmosphere. Light and neutral tones like ivory, taupe, and soft greige not only reflect light, but also evoke a sense of openness and tranquility. These colors are versatile, allowing for subtle visual interest through texturing or accent pieces without overwhelming the space.
Practical application involves considering traffic patterns and exposure to natural light. In high-traffic areas, opt for paint that hides wear and tear easily. For spaces with ample natural light, choose hues that can handle brightness without fading quickly. Incorporating Textures to Enhance the Airstreams of Your Minimalist Bathroom
When designing a minimalist bathroom remodel, textures play a significant role in enhancing the desired airy atmosphere. Soft, natural materials like linen, cotton, and bamboo can add a touch of warmth to the space while maintaining its open feel. Incorporating these textures through towels, shower curtains, or even wall hangings creates visual interest without overwhelming the clean lines of your design.
For an elevated look, consider mixing and matching different textures. A silk shower curtain against a woven bamboo mat creates a luxurious yet minimalist contrast. Similarly, adding a plush, high-pile rug in neutral tones under the sink or tub can make the space feel more inviting and less clinical. These texture layers subtly hint at depth, breaking up the monotony of pure white walls and creating an overall soothing ambiance.
